## FAQ: tailcat CLI access

Q: tailcat won't stream logs from the Ostermill cluster — now what?

A: Check your session token first; most failures are expired sessions. If tailcat still refuses after refresh, the log broker needs a manual unseal. Do not restart the broker. Use the emergency unseal flow and report it at the next eng sync. The unseal passphrase follows.

unlock words, yawig-kagef: gordor-holvan-ulaael-pramir-ulaiel-tamdor

**First-Aid Room — Night Access (Dray Tower)**

The first-aid room is on Level 2, beside the service lift, door marked FA-2. Stocked kit, defib, cot. Night shift: do not wait for a warden — access it directly if needed. Log any use in the red binder inside the door. Restock requests go to Facilities via the morning handover. The door locks automatically after 21:00, so you will need the night-access code to get in.

staff pass of kawip-hawef = bdg-QLP-2

# Catalog cache invalidation for the Brindlewick storefront.
# Product edits in the Merchantry admin publish an invalidation event; the
# catalog service fans it out to edge caches within 30 seconds. Stale reads
# beyond that window usually mean the purge worker lost its broker session.
# The worker authenticates to the purge broker with the credential set on
# the next line.

sealed setting: ARCHIVE_KEY3=8d0

Quick note for reviewers: every Bucketeer release artifact gets signed before it hits the Larkspur registry, no exceptions. The CI job builds the assignment-service image, runs the experiment-config sanity checks, then signs the digest. If you're approving a release PR, verify the signature matches what's pinned in `release.lock` — a mismatch means someone rebuilt outside CI, which should block the merge. Unsigned artifacts get rejected by the deploy gate automatically. For local verification, use the public key below.

release key, kagaf-tahop: bky6_tFmur5